Jamshedpur, July 12: The election process for key posts in the Adityapur Small Industries Association (ASIA) has officially begun, with several entrepreneurs filing their nomination papers before election officers S.N. Khandelwal and Saroj Kant Jha on Friday.
For the President’s post, two candidates — Inder Kumar Agarwal and Santosh Kumar Khetan — submitted their nominations. The race for General Secretary will be between Praveen Gutgutia and Santokh Singh, while Rajkumar Sanghi and Pradeep Kumar Jain are vying for the Treasurer’s position.
Five candidates — R.K. Sinha, S.N. Thakur, Dilip Kumar Goyal, Vimal Kumar Singh, and Rajiv Ranjan Munna — filed for the post of Trustee, which will be filled through a selection process.
For the four Vice-President positions, nominations were received from Rajkumar Sanghi, Sudhir Kumar Singh, Devang Gandhi, Santokh Singh, and Dashrath Upadhyay. Likewise, for the four Secretary posts, Pinkesh Maheshwari, Mandeep Singh, Ashok Kumar Gupta, and Divyanshu Sinha submitted nominations.
A total of 22 candidates, including Anil Kumar Agarwal, Ravindra Singh, Deepak Panchamia, and others, filed papers for 21 Executive Member posts.
The scrutiny of nomination papers will be held on July 14, followed by the publication of the valid nominations list at the ASIA Bhawan office. July 15 (until 4 PM) is the deadline for withdrawal of nominations, and the final list of candidates will be released by 4 PM on July 16.
The general election will be held on July 19, from 12:30 PM to 4:00 PM, at the Adityapur Auto Cluster premises.
